Revised Second Draft script for the 1985 television film, which originally aired on NBC on March 18, 1985. Copy belonging to a crew member, with their name in manuscript ink on the title page and on several printed labels throughout the script. With a few small manuscript pencil annotations throughout, most editorial in nature. A dedicated therapist treats a woman who feels she can't control her sexual urges, and a taxi driver experiencing auditory hallucinations. Self wrappers. Title page integral with front wrapper, dated October 22, 1984, noted as SECOND REVISION, with credits for screenwriters David Seltzer and Thom Thomas. 127 leaves, with last page of text numbered 112. Xerographic duplication, rectos only, with rainbow revision pages throughout, dated variously between 10/31/84 and 11/28/84. Pages Very Good plus, bound with three gold brads. First Draft script for the 1979 film. Father Brian (Dyke) is a priest in a depressing mining town, until one day a new Sister, Rita (Quinlan) joins his parish and changes his perception of life. She is trusting and kind and listens to Father Brian, but their relationship takes a turn for the worse, landing Father Brian in the role of suspect. Blue production company (Mel Simon Productions) wrappers. Title page present, dated May 10, 1978, noted as FIRST DRAFT, with credits for screenwriter Stitt and director Kramer. Last leaf of text numbered 129. Xerographic duplication, with photocopied punch holes. Pages and wrapper Near Fine, bound internally with two gold brads.

Two vintage photographs of Sidney Lumet directing on the set of the 1962 film. With manuscript annotations and a rubber stamp on the versos of each. Based on the 1955 play by Arthur Miller, about an unhappily married man whose obsession with his niece leads to tragedy when she falls for an immigrant who is staying with them. The first American film to feature a kiss between two men, though ultimately it is an act of accusation against one of the men, rather than a romantic one. Shot on location in New York City, and Rome. 7.5 x 5.5 inches. Near Fine.

Vintage reference photograph of actress Janet Leigh, in a brunette wig, relaxing on the set of the 1963 film. Stamps of The Associated Press and Le Parisien on the verso. Based on the 1960 Tony Award winning stage musical of the same name with a book by Michael Stewart, lyrics by Lee Adams and music by Charles Strouse. An unsuccessful pop songwriter is convinced he can make his fortune if he can get recently drafted rock and roll star Conrad Birdie on the Ed Sullivan show to kiss his high school girlfriend goodbye. Nominated for 2 Academy Awards. 7 x 9 inches. Near Fine. Godard, Histoire(s) du cinema.
